Outline of Final Research Achievements |
The aim of this study is to clarify the physiological functions of novel peptides, NMU- and NMS-related peptide (NU1 and NU2, respectively) in hypothalamus. The morphological analysis using autoradiography indicated the existence of specific binding sites for novel peptides in the rat brain. Intraventricular (ICV) administration of NU1 and NU2 increased the food intake. During the dark phase, ICV administration of these peptides increased the body temperature. In addition, ICV-injection of NU1 and NU2 affected the locomotor activity and the energy expenditure. These results suggest that NU1 and NU2 play important roles in the hypothalamus.
